Express top Hurricanes 147-124

The Windsor Express beat the Halifax Hurricanes 147-124 in NBLC action on Wednesday.

The Express held a four-point advantage by the end of the first quarter and extended their lead to 75-60 as the game entered halftime.  Windsor continued to lead 116-91 at the end of the third and Halifax wasn't able to catch up in the final frame and ended the game with a 23-point deficit.

Chris Jones led Windsor with a game-high 38 points and six assists. Ryan Anderson added another 35 points of his own and three assists, while Juan Pattillo put up 21 points and had 11 rebounds.

The Express are at home again March 13 to take on the London Lightning at 7 p.m.
